MAY 2014This month's masthead photo is a repeat from a few months back. HMS Portchester Castle was a Castle-class corvette launched on 21 June 1943 at Swan Hunter shipyard in Newcastle upon Tyne. She was the only RN ship to be named after Portchester Castle in Hampshire. |

MARCH 2014This month's masthead photo is HK Models' new big new 1/32 Gloster Meteor F.4 kit. The Gloster Meteor was the first British jet fighter & the Allies' first operational jet aircraft. The Meteor's evolution was heavily reliant on its ground-breaking turbojet engines, advanced by Sir Frank Whittle & his company, Power Jets Ltd. |

FEBRUARY 2014This month's masthead photo is HMS Gorleston, a Banff-class escort sloop. She was one of ten U.S. Coast Guard Lake-class cutters--the entire class--transferred to the Royal Navy in 1941 under the provisions of Lend-Lease.
